Mobile-first indexing

What is mobile-first indexing?

Mobile-first indexing is a method used by search engines to analyze and rank websites based on their mobile version. In the past, search engines primarily looked at the desktop version of a site for ranking purposes. However, with the rise in mobile usage, search engines now prioritize the mobile version of a site when determining its search engine ranking positions.

How does it affect websites?

If your website is not mobile-friendly or lacks a mobile version, it may not rank as high in search engine results. This can have a significant impact on your website’s visibility and organic traffic. Mobile-first indexing highlights the importance of mobile optimization and encourages website owners to prioritize mobile usability.

The role of mobile speed optimization

Impact of page loading speed

The loading speed of your website has a direct impact on user experience and engagement. Studies have shown that users are more likely to abandon a website if it takes too long to load, particularly on mobile devices. Slow-loading pages can negatively affect bounce rates, conversion rates, and overall user satisfaction. By prioritizing mobile speed optimization, you can significantly improve user experience and increase the chances of retaining visitors.

Optimizing images and media

Images and media files can heavily contribute to page loading times. Compressing images without sacrificing quality and optimizing media formats can significantly improve loading speeds. Additionally, utilize lazy loading techniques to only load media when it is visible on the screen. By optimizing images and media, you can reduce file sizes and improve overall site performance on mobile devices.

Minimizing code and file sizes

Bulky code and large file sizes can slow down your website’s loading speed, especially on mobile devices with limited bandwidth. Minimize unnecessary code and scripts, and combine and compress CSS and JavaScript files. Additionally, reduce the file sizes of downloadable assets such as PDFs and documents. By minimizing code and file sizes, you can improve the efficiency of your website and ensure faster loading times.

Utilizing browser caching

Browser caching allows repeated visitors to load your website more quickly by storing static files on their devices. Enable browser caching to reduce the amount of data that needs to be downloaded for subsequent visits. By utilizing browser caching, you can further enhance the loading speed of your website and improve the overall user experience on mobile devices.

Optimizing the checkout process

The checkout process is a critical aspect of mobile optimization for e-commerce websites. Simplify and streamline the checkout process as much as possible, minimizing the number of steps required to complete a purchase. Use autofill options and optimize input fields for mobile devices to make entering information easier. By enhancing the mobile checkout experience, you can reduce cart abandonment rates and increase conversion rates.

Mobile payment options

Offering a variety of mobile payment options is crucial for mobile optimization in e-commerce. Ensure that your website supports popular mobile payment methods such as Apple Pay and Google Pay. By providing seamless and secure options for mobile payments, you can enhance the convenience and user experience for mobile shoppers, ultimately driving more sales.

Future trends in mobile optimization

Accelerated Mobile Pages (AMP)

Accelerated Mobile Pages (AMP) is an open-source initiative designed to create fast-loading mobile web pages. By utilizing a stripped-down version of HTML, CSS, and JavaScript, AMP aims to provide an ultra-fast and user-friendly mobile browsing experience. Implementing AMP can significantly enhance your website’s mobile speed optimization, resulting in improved user engagement and better search engine rankings.

Progressive Web Apps (PWA)

Progressive Web Apps (PWA) combine the best elements of websites and native mobile apps. PWAs provide users with an app-like experience directly through their web browsers, eliminating the need for app downloads. With features such as push notifications and offline browsing capabilities, PWAs offer enhanced functionality and a seamless user experience. By adopting PWAs, businesses can bridge the gap between web and app experiences, further optimizing for mobile users.
